How to monetise Twitch? Simple, follow these steps.
1. Find your own.
Whether it's a game, a certain genre or a trick that few know how to do. Another tip is to be fun. You may not be one of the most skilled players but you can get players by being one of the funniest.
2. Establish a regular transmission schedule.
This is so fans know when to tune in. Use your existing social media accounts such as YouTube, Twitter, Instagram and Facebook to promote your Twitch broadcasts.
It is important that you don't forget to support other Twitch users by watching and participating in their streams.
3. Interact with your audience
Once you engage viewers, interact with them. It's nice if you can ask them questions about what they want you to do, change or try new things.
Answer your viewers' questions and queries. An entertaining broadcaster keeps followers tuning in for broadcast after broadcast. They'll also look forward to seeing you do what they've asked you to do.

5. Get donations
Twitch users like to support their favourite streamers. One of the main ways they do this is by donating money to their favourite streamers. A brilliant idea is to have a "donate" button added to your channel.
This way users who enjoy your broadcasts can make donations via PayPal or a third-party app, such as Streamlabs. You don't know if anyone will want to donate money to you, but it never hurts for viewers to have that option.
6. Get sponsors
Once you have turned your hobby into a real job, you can create your own brand and sell it.
In the same way, if you become really popular you will be able to contact different brands to get different sponsors.
